Hyaluronic Acid Injections: A Closer Look

Hyaluronic acid injections have gained popularity for their ability to improve joint function and reduce pain, particularly in patients with osteoarthritis. These injections are designed to supplement the viscosity of the joint fluid, which often becomes degraded in arthritic conditions. This results in better shock absorption and smoother joint movement. Cortisone Injections and Their Role in Pain Management

Cortisone injections are another widely used treatment for arthritis-related joint pain. They are particularly effective in reducing acute inflammation and providing rapid relief. Common uses of cortisone injections include:

  • Managing flare-ups of joint inflammation
  • Providing temporary relief to facilitate physical therapy
  • Delaying surgical intervention

While cortisone can be highly effective, it is essential to use it judiciously, as repeated injections over a short period may lead to side effects such as joint weakening or increased blood sugar levels. Nevertheless, when administered properly and monitored by a healthcare provider, these injections remain a reliable option for many arthritis patients.

Innovations in Drug Delivery Systems for Joint Health

Advancements in medical technology have significantly impacted how drugs are delivered to joints. The concept of “Designing Drug Delivery Systems for Articular Joints” is increasingly gaining attention from researchers and clinicians. These systems aim to improve the precision and duration of therapeutic effects while minimizing side effects.

Innovative delivery systems being developed include:

  • Liposomal and nanoparticle-based carriers for sustained drug release
  • Injectable hydrogels that provide prolonged therapeutic presence in the joint
  • Microsphere formulations for controlled dosage over time

Such technologies are particularly beneficial for chronic conditions like osteoarthritis, where ongoing management is crucial. These systems may eventually enhance the efficacy of treatments like hyaluronic acid and cortisone injections, making them even more reliable options for long-term joint health.
